Transaction ec4ab882240e3fae32ea33e9719076b548e886f5c065333aa85e827a48e99e6a
1 Input
1 Output
-
ec4ab882240e3fae32ea33e9719076b548e886f5c065333aa85e827a48e99e6a:0
- value
- 41797728
- script pubkey
- OP_0 OP_PUSHBYTES_20 b77d3e275969b8b3d9166c0bfe0502e825659297
- address
- bc1qka7nuf6edxut8kgkds9lupgzaqjkty5hevg3c7